    Description


    The Manager of Veterinary Recruiting holds a pivotal role within VCA, responsible for the seamless management of the specialty recruiting team's day-to-day operations and oversight of the Intern Career Advisor program.

    This role involves close collaboration with teammates to actively contribute to the development of talent pipelines for specialty and internship positions in VCA hospitals across the United States.

    Additionally, the Manager serves as a subject matter expert, offering valuable insights and expertise on recruiting strategies, processes, and industry trends.

    Strong leadership skills and the ability to collaborate effectively with a large, remote workforce are essential qualities for success in this position.

    Responsibilities:
    Develop and lead VCA's Specialty Recruiting Program
    Oversee support of VCA's current Interns and encourage retention through individual and group communication, in-person meetings, hosting a lecture series, and partnership with VCA Intern Directors
    Manage the day-to-day performance of the specialty recruiting team and mentor, coach, and grow recruiting team members to align with business needs
    Develop and manage recruiting metrics, and evaluate the recruiting processes, team, and training to further expand upon our existing recruiting practices, ensuring consistency and best practices are followed throughout the recruiting lifecycle
    Manage and continue to develop the Travel ER, GP, and other travel position programs at VCA nationwide.
    Fulfill other related duties as assigned
    Present the recruiting strategy and results at regional field meetings as necessary, and travel to national conferences, school campuses, and VCA hospitals as necessary
    Engage and partner with the hiring managers/department leaders to understand hiring requirements, set realistic expectations and educate on the recruiting process

    Qualifications:
    DVM or Bachelor's Degree in Veterinary Medicine, preferred
    5-10 years recruiting experience, 5+ years supervisory experience
    Recruiting experience in the veterinary industry
    Basic computer skills
    Knowledge of Applicant Tracking Systems and CRM software
    Ability to read, write, and speak English
    *All degrees will be deemed "or equivalent combination of education and experience" unless absolutely required to do the job (i.e., DVM degree for Veterinarian, Law degree for Attorney, etc.).
    Additional Information
    Compensation is negotiable based on education, experience, and other relevant credentials. The US base salary range for this full-time position is $98,400 - $118,000.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level, and location .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process. Please note that the compensation details listed in US role postings reflect the base salary only.
